Back in the 60s, a group known as The Zombies had a song entitled "I Love You." The refrain ended with "...but the words won't come, and I don't know what to say." That's where I was last night and again this morning as I worked on TG for today. The words were a no-show. MIA. The fires up in the panhandle consumed not only lives and homes and livestock and everything else in their paths, but they consumed my thoughts as well. Mrs. NT and I grew up there, have lots of family up there, and we have a kinship with everybody else. We watched a man in Fritch being interviewed on local news. In the background was a pile of smoldering rubble---his home. He wanted to be stoic, but he cried enough tears to put out another fire. My wife began sobbing softly, and I followed suit.

Against that backdrop, here came that inevitable question, from an unseen source, "Ok, Gift Boy, where's that faith you're always yammering about? Speak up, I can't hear you." Faith is easily proclaimed when you're standing on a hillside or a mountaintop, but it's far more elusive when you're facedown in a ditch. All I could think of was that sometimes God calms the storm, and other times He calms us. This ol' world doesn't meet any of our definitions of "perfect." There is no Camelot, nor was one promised to us. But with Faith, we can absorb the body blows, and get back up.

We were spared the pain and suffering of loss, so today, we're going to look for ways to help those who weren't so fortunate.
